A cone is14cm and it's base radius is 4•5 calculate the volume of water that is exactly half volume of the cone
4 years ago

Answers

Answered by oobleck
the full volume is 1/3 πr^2 h, so you want 1/6 πr^2 h
plug in your numbers.
